Florence has to be one of my favourite cities in Europe. The combination of fantastic food, unrivalled art galleries, and a wonderful setting on the River Arno surrounded by the Tuscan countryside make it the ideal place for a short city break. My wife and I chose Florence to celebrate our wedding anniversary and it was perfect. We stayed in the excellent 5 star Hotel Relais Santa Croce right in the heart of Florence which made exploring the city easy. This elegant hotel is housed in an 18th Century palazzo and the rooms are stylishly designed with a mixture of classic and contemporary furnishings. They have a fantastic fine dining restaurant which we dined at on our first night and it is the ideal place to celebrate a special occasion. We spent our time in Florence sightseeing; visiting the excellent museums and galleries, including the vast Uffizi Gallery and the Accademia Gallery where Michelangelo’s breathtaking statue of David is displayed. We of course managed to squeeze some shopping time in. Florence is one of the best places to buy leather goods and Sarah was able to buy a new handbag from one the leather shops near the famous Ponte Vecchio bridge. Early evening we climbed the steep steps up to the Piazzale Michelangelo, which is the ideal place to sit with a cold beer or an Aperol Spritz, and watch the sunset. The views of Florence below are stunning. Having dined in the hotel’s restaurant on our first night we wanted to try some of the local cuisine and one of my favourite restaurants in Florence is the lovely Trattoria Del Fagioli, a wonderful local restaurant that feels like you are stepping back in time. The menu is ever changing based on seasonal produce and the owner will happily make recommendations for you. We skipped dessert in the restaurant and headed to Gelateria della Passera for some of the best ice cream I’ve ever had. 2 nights in Florence isn’t quite enough so I’m already planning our next trip and next time we will definitely find time to squeeze in a tour out to the Chianti wine region to wander amongst the vineyards and sample a glass or two!
